Jason Bateman Celebrates Family at Toronto Film Festival Premiere

Actor and director, Jason Bateman, presented his family with great pride at the 2025 Toronto International Film Festival (TIFF). He was joined by them at the premiere of his new film, “Black Rabbit.” The event took place at TIFF Lightbox in Toronto, Ontario, on September 7th, 2025. Bateman walked the red carpet with his wife Amanda Anka and their two daughters – Francesca Nora Bateman & Maple Sylvie Bateman.

For Anka and Bateman, it’s been more than twenty years of wedded bliss. Their close relationship is founded on respect and admiration for each other. Still, as he tracks the pace of his own demanding career, Bateman admits that Anka regularly has to shoulder the burden of a family life. He thanked her for her steadfast support, proclaiming,

“I would like to say, specifically though, to my wife, my two daughters — Amanda, Franny and Maple — without you, none of it would be enjoyable and it probably wouldn’t be possible.” – Jason Bateman

At the premiere, Bateman sported a cool gray short-sleeved button up shirt. Francesca Nora stunned in a backless, sheer black dress and Maple Sylvie wore an elegant brown satin gown. Anka matched them with her stylish black vest top and pants.
